    Taken from the Avsim review..
    If you look at the tail, you’ll notice there’s a drag chute folded up over the exhaust novel. No, it doesn’t deploy. As Mr.
    Kok explained on the support forum, “The chute is only used in rather special occasions (short runway with low
    braking action) and certainly not used standard. We discussed it but in the end decided that adding all that code
    made little sense and never would look realistic. To make a realistic looking and above all WORKING (meaning it
    would increase braking in regards to speed/wind) just was not worth the effort. If it could not be done at least semirealistic we would not do it.
